Andalucia Birdwatching - November 2009

THE autumn migration did not happen this year. The expected flights of small flocks of Black Kites, Honey Buzzards and various Eagles did not appear. The reason, high winds and weather systems originating in the south and blowing north in Europe made the normal migration routes through the Gibraltar Straits difficult. As a result the majority of migrating birds made their way south by crossing into France and then south through mainland Europe.

The river level was very low this month making observation of the fish and wildlife on the riverbank easy. Friends of mine reported seeing a brown furry animal briefly on the river bank and in the water margins with some controversy of its species, ie. Otter, Mink, Mongoose etc.

On the 16th while walking along the riverbank at twilight the animal passed by immediately below in mid stream allowing the water current to carry it along. I can confirm that the mystery animal was an Otter.

In the last week of the month Egrets began to appear on the flood plane. Easily spotted by their pure white plumage and habit of following the livestock around (in our case sheep). As the week passed more and more appear until up to 20 birds could be seen, however they would disappear at twilight and reappear at first light. They left to roost altogether in the low trees overhanging the river in the village next door to the El Gecko Hotel. Next to the Egret roost the Grey Herons decided to set up shop. So the veranda behind the El Gecko Hotel where both Egrets and Herons circle in at twilight is the place to be.
